Company Overview

Macarthur Minerals Limited,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the exploration and evaluation of mineral resource properties. It primarily explores for gold, lithium, iron ore, and nickel deposits. The company holds interests in three iron ore projects in the Yilgarn region of Western Australia; two exploration project areas in the Pilbara, Western Australia targeting iron ore; and lithium brine interests in the Railroad Valley, Nevada, the United States. The company was formerly known as Macarthur Diamonds Limited and changed its name to Macarthur Minerals Limited in July 2005. Macarthur Minerals Limited was incorporated in 2002 and is headquartered in Milton, Australia.
